python获取数据—Python获取数据写到Excel:代码示例

pythondaimakaiyuan

温馨提示:这篇文章已超过283天没有更新,请注意相关的内容是否还可用!

python获取数据—Python获取数据写到Excel:代码示例

Python可以通过使用第三方库来获取数据并将其写入Excel文件中。其中,常用的库包括pandas和openpyxl。

我们需要安装这两个库。可以使用以下命令来安装它们:

pip install pandas openpyxl

接下来,我们需要导入这两个库:

import pandas as pd

from openpyxl import Workbook

然后,我们可以使用pandas库中的`read_csv()`函数来读取数据。该函数可以从CSV文件中读取数据,并将其转换为DataFrame对象。DataFrame是pandas库中用于处理表格数据的一种数据结构。

data = pd.read_csv('data.csv')

在上述代码中,我们假设数据存储在名为"data.csv"的CSV文件中。读取后的数据将保存在名为"data"的DataFrame对象中。

接下来,我们可以使用openpyxl库中的Workbook类创建一个新的Excel文件:

wb = Workbook()

然后,我们可以使用pandas库中的`to_excel()`函数将DataFrame对象中的数据写入到Excel文件中。该函数接受一个文件名作为参数,并将数据写入到指定的Excel文件中。

data.to_excel('output.xlsx', index=False)

在上述代码中,我们假设要将数据写入到名为"output.xlsx"的Excel文件中。`index=False`参数表示不将索引列写入到Excel文件中。

完整的代码示例如下:

import pandas as pd

from openpyxl import Workbook

# 读取数据

data = pd.read_csv('data.csv')

# 创建Excel文件

wb = Workbook()

# 将数据写入Excel文件

data.to_excel('output.xlsx', index=False)

执行上述代码后,将会在当前目录下生成一个名为"output.xlsx"的Excel文件,其中包含了从CSV文件中读取的数据。

文章版权声明:除非注明,否则均为莫宇前端原创文章,转载或复制请以超链接形式并注明出处。

取消
微信二维码
微信二维码
支付宝二维码